Message type: E = Error
Message class: PCA - Message Class for Production Campaign
Message number: 048
Message text: Order type &1 not intended for process orders

PCA048
- Order type &1 not intended for process orders ?The SAP error message PCA048 ("Order type &1 not intended for process orders") typically occurs when you attempt to create or process a process order using an order type that is not configured for process orders in the system. This can happen in various scenarios, such as when trying to create a process order in the wrong context or using an incorrect order type.
Cause:
- Incorrect Order Type: The order type you are trying to use is not defined as a process order type in the system.
- Configuration Issues: The order type may not be properly configured in the system settings for process orders.
- User Error: The user may have selected the wrong order type inadvertently.
Solution:
Check Order Type Configuration:
- Go to the transaction code
OPL8
(Order Type Configuration) in SAP.- Verify that the order type you are using is set up for process orders. You can check the settings under the "General Data" and "Control Data" sections.
- Ensure that the order type is marked as a process order type.
Use the Correct Order Type:
- If the order type is not intended for process orders, you will need to select a different order type that is configured for process orders. Common process order types include
PP01
,PP02
, etc.Consult with SAP Basis or Configuration Team:
- If you do not have the necessary permissions to check or change the configuration, consult with your SAP Basis or configuration team to ensure that the order type is correctly set up.
Review Documentation:
- Check the SAP documentation or your organization's internal documentation for guidelines on which order types are intended for process orders.
